无VTX配置下VMware使用指南
不开启vtx 配置vmware

首页 2025-02-09 09:59:58



不开启VT-x配置VMware:挑战、影响与替代策略 在虚拟化技术日新月异的今天,VMware作为业界领先的虚拟化解决方案提供商,为企业和个人用户提供了强大的虚拟化平台

    然而,在配置VMware时,一个关键的决策点在于是否启用Intel的VT-x(或AMD的AMD-V)虚拟化技术

    VT-x技术允许单个物理CPU同时运行多个操作系统和应用程序,极大地提高了虚拟机的性能和效率

    然而,在某些特定场景下,用户可能选择不开启VT-x配置VMware

    本文将深入探讨不开启VT-x配置VMware所带来的挑战、影响以及可行的替代策略

     一、VT-x技术概述 VT-x(Virtualization Technology for x86)是Intel推出的一项硬件虚拟化技术,旨在提高虚拟机的运行效率和性能

    通过VT-x,CPU可以直接支持虚拟机的运行,无需通过软件模拟,从而显著降低了虚拟化带来的性能开销

    AMD也推出了类似的虚拟化技术,称为AMD-V

    这些技术使得虚拟机能够更高效地访问硬件资源,提高了虚拟环境的稳定性和响应速度

     二、不开启VT-x配置VMware的挑战 尽管VT-x技术带来了诸多优势,但在某些情况下,用户可能选择不开启这一功能

    这可能是出于硬件兼容性、安全考虑或特定应用场景的需求

    然而,不开启VT-x配置VMware将带来一系列挑战: 1. 性能下降 最直接的影响是虚拟机的性能下降

    没有VT-x的支持,VMware必须通过软件模拟来执行虚拟化操作,这会导致CPU资源的额外消耗,降低虚拟机的运行速度和响应时间

    对于需要处理大量数据或运行复杂应用程序的虚拟机来说,这种性能下降尤为明显

     2. 稳定性问题 不开启VT-x还可能导致虚拟机的稳定性问题

    由于软件模拟的局限性,虚拟机在运行时可能会遇到更多的兼容性和稳定性挑战

    这可能导致虚拟机频繁崩溃、重启或无法正常运行,从而影响业务连续性和用户体验

     3. 资源限制 在没有VT-x支持的情况下,VMware对虚拟机的资源分配将受到更多限制

    例如,CPU和内存的分配可能无法达到最佳状态,导致虚拟机在处理高负载任务时表现不佳

    此外,虚拟机的数量和类型也可能受到限制,无法满足多样化的应用需求

     4. 安全风险 虽然VT-x本身并不直接提供安全功能,但它为虚拟化环境提供了更强的隔离性

    不开启VT-x可能使得虚拟机之间的隔离性减弱,增加了安全风险

    在多租户环境中,这种安全风险尤为突出

     三、不开启VT-x配置VMware的影响 不开启VT-x配置VMware的影响是多方面的,不仅限于性能下降和稳定性问题

    以下是对几个关键方面的深入分析: 1. 开发与测试环境 对于开发和测试团队来说,虚拟机的性能至关重要

    不开启VT-x可能导致开发和测试周期延长,因为虚拟机在处理复杂任务时速度较慢

    此外,稳定性问题也可能导致测试结果不准确,影响产品的质量和发布时间

     2. 生产环境 在生产环境中,虚拟机的性能和稳定性直接关系到业务的连续性和用户满意度

    不开启VT-x可能导致虚拟机无法满足业务需求,影响业务效率和用户体验

    此外,资源限制可能限制业务的扩展和灵活性

     3. 教育与培训 在教育和培训领域,虚拟机常用于模拟真实环境进行教学和实践

    不开启VT-x可能导致虚拟机无法提供足够的性能和稳定性,影响教学效果和学习体验

     四、替代策略与解决方案 面对不开启VT-x配置VMware所带来的挑战和影响,用户可以采取以下替代策略和解决方案: 1. 硬件升级 如果硬件支持VT-x但尚未启用,考虑升级BIOS或固件以启用该功能

    这通常是最简单且最有效的解决方案

     2. 使用轻量级虚拟机 对于性能要求不高的应用场景,可以考虑使用轻量级虚拟机或容器技术

    这些技术通常对硬件资源的要求较低,可以在不开启VT-x的情况下提供可接受的性能

     3. 优化虚拟机配置 通过优化虚拟机的配置,如调整CPU和内存的分配、禁用不必要的服务和应用程序等,可以在一定程度上缓解性能下降的问题

    然而,这种优化通常有限度,无法完全替代VT-x带来的性能提升

     4. 采用物理服务器 对于对性能要求极高的应用场景,可以考虑采用物理服务器而不是虚拟机

    虽然这会增加硬件成本和管理复杂性,但可以提供更高的性能和稳定性

     5. 利用云服务 云服务提供商通常提供高性能的虚拟化环境,这些环境通常已经启用了VT-x等技术

    通过利用云服务,用户可以在不担心硬件限制的情况下获得高性能的虚拟化解决方案

     五、结论 综上所述,不开启VT-x配置VMware将带来一系列挑战和影响,包括性能下降、稳定性问题、资源限制和安全风险等

    然而,通过采取替代策略和解决方案,如硬件升级、使用轻量级虚拟机、优化虚拟机配置、采用物理服务器或利用云服务,用户可以在一定程度上缓解这些问题

    在选择是否开启VT-x时,用户应综合考虑业务需求、硬件兼容性、安全考虑和成本效益等因素,做出最适合自己的决策

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道